This Title Comedy Song has received NATIONAL and INTERNATIONAL airplay on the following Comedy Radio Shows: "Dr. Demento", "The April Winchell Show", "Uncle Al", DFSX "Dave's Fun Stuff", "Odd Oldies", "Comedy 101 Radio" and many more since it's release.

Hanukkah Harry and Santa Claus, brother's of the Holiday Season, were involved in a little known altercation that led to blows between the two of them. Listen to the Story as told by an observer, Sy Hymowitz (Hal L.Singer), who was dining that evening at Maury's Deli, where it all happened. In his own words... "I Saw Hanukkah Harry Beat Up Santa!"

Reports have been made for years about those who have seen "Elvis Presley." Maybe they have and maybe not, but someone heard him recording two songs on this album: "Rockin' Christmas Stockin'" and "My Warm Christmas Heart." Bound by legal agreement, we're not allowed to say, but if it was "Elvis," he now goes by the name of Dennis Kolb.

Frosty has nothing over this guy on the block. Meet "Mr. Snow," they all call him Joe. He's Cool, Classy, Uptown and his friends never see a winter without him.

Go back to the sounds of yesteryear and hear the traditional favorite "God Rest Ye Merry Gentlemen" performed as an instrumental by Hal L. Singer. He plays all the instruments in this song which makes it all the more interesting. Other traditional sounding holiday songs on this album are "The Joy Of Christmas Day" performed by Mike Light and "The Old Christmas Hearth" performed by Georganna Barry-Singer
